I have found that there are several small bumps on my left testicle. They are inside the scrotum. Should I be concerned?

Anytime you notice something different about your body such as bumps, lumps, rashes, etc. you should make an appointment with your health care provider to get checked out. Small bumps can be caused from an allergic reaction to something your testicles have come in contact with, ingrown hairs, pimples, cysts, genital herpes or warts (if you are sexually active) or something else. In general, if the bumps are not new, you have no itching, pain, redness or other signs of infection, and you are not sexually active, it may just be normal for you, but there is no way to know for sure unless a medical provider checks you.
